The history of the medium is a documented climb, and it is worth walking rung by rung, because the shape of the climb is the whole argument. It begins with the living voice — the highest fidelity we ever had and the shortest reach — and ascends through every technology that let a symbol outlast its speaker and travel farther than a shout: clay and stone, papyrus, the bound codex, and then the press that made the copy cheap[9].
And when the word first went electric, the medium recorded its own annunciation. The first official message down the American telegraph, in 1844, chosen by a young woman and sent by Morse from the Capitol, was a verse: "What hath God wrought"[10]†. At the exact instant distance began to collapse, the wire's first word was a marvel at what God had done. Then the unglamorous rungs — telex, fax — and then the internet, where reach at last goes vertical.
The internet finished Gutenberg's work and overshot it: not cheap copies but infinite perfect copies at zero marginal cost, anywhere, instantly[12]. Distribution — the problem every prior medium struggled against — was solved absolutely. A single person can now place a sentence within reach of every connected person alive, for nothing.
But reach was never the whole of it. Shannon's theorem is exact here: a channel's capacity is not raw bandwidth but bandwidth weighted by the signal-to-noise ratio — C = B log₂(1 + S/N)[13]. The internet raised B without bound and taxed S/N to the floor. More arrived, and less was understood; the pile grew faster than anyone could read it. We solved the copying and buried the meaning. For thirty years that was simply the condition of the age: everything available, almost nothing findable — reach at infinity, sense on the floor.
